Transaction 131aeed149dafdb850c515936719d3c0709f753f90a05027f98462e0abf43867

1 Input
2 Outputs
  • 131aeed149dafdb850c515936719d3c0709f753f90a05027f98462e0abf43867:0
  • value  2008333
    address  39QttBDrB13aNA8bweRaMkTf7eS1o7qBnr
  • 131aeed149dafdb850c515936719d3c0709f753f90a05027f98462e0abf43867:1
  • value  354739
    address  bc1qxuqehnr5wqvzgnn7r5s4tfcyzf0q407d8rlc03